Julia Bell Lancaster, 89, of Weirton, WV passed away on Tuesday, January 31, 2023.

Julia was born in Weirton, WV on December 23, 1933, the fourth of six children born to Ossman Mehamet and Daisy Nutter Mallas.

At the age of 16, Julia married Hartzell Lancaster. In their 54 years of marriage, they were blessed with three daughters, a son, seven grandchildren, and eventually two great grandchildren.

A special lady, Julia had a heart of gold. Her family meant the world to her. When she was able, she attended all her grandchildren’s activities. She loved to feed anyone who walked through her front door.

Julia retired as a cashier from G.C. Murphy’s in Weirton.
